Ty Pennington became a household name through his energetic style and hands-on approach to home improvement on the hit show Trading Spaces. As a carpenter and television host, he blends practical skill with clear communication, making DIY projects feel accessible to everyday viewers.
Beyond the quick transformations on camera, Ty built a career centered on craftsmanship, public speaking, and media presence. His work on Trading Spaces and subsequent projects shaped his reputation as a reliable expert in home renovation and design.

Trading Spaces Renovation Style
Ty approached each Trading Spaces challenge with a focus on smart layout changes and durable craftsmanship. He often worked under tight deadlines, which showcased his ability to stay calm and maintain quality when time was limited.
His renovation style emphasized clean lines, efficient use of space, and subtle design touches that elevated the home without overwhelming it. Viewers learned to appreciate technical details behind seemingly simple updates.
DIY Skills and Carpentry Techniques
Ty frequently demonstrated precise carpentry methods, from accurate measuring and cutting to proper fastening and finishing. These techniques helped homeowners understand that professional results are achievable with the right tools and planning.
He emphasized safety, tool maintenance, and layout precision, encouraging DIYers to slow down and focus on quality. By explaining each step clearly, he made complex tasks more approachable for beginners.
Home Improvement Project Planning
Effective project planning was central to Ty’s success on Trading Spaces. He typically started with a clear scope, realistic timeline, and budget, then adjusted as new constraints appeared during demolition or material sourcing.
His planning process included site measurements, material lists, contingency strategies, and communication with homeowners. This methodical approach reduced surprises and kept projects on track despite tight schedules.

How did Ty Pennington get noticed on Trading Spaces?
Ty’s high-energy work style, technical skill, and ability to explain changes clearly made him stand out among carpenters on the show, leading to frequent viewer recognition.
What tools does Ty recommend for DIY home projects?
He often highlights a solid measuring tape, quality circular saw, cordless drill, level, and a good set of hand tools, stressing that proper technique matters more than having every gadget.
